miR-122 Release in Exosomes Precedes Overt Tolvaptan-Induced Necrosis in a Primary Human Hepatocyte Micropatterned Coculture Model
Idiosyncratic drug-induced liver injury (IDILI) is thought to often result from an adaptive immune attack on the liver.
